    From: Lennie

    On Jun 24, 2005

    My whole family really enjoyed these chops. I found the mustard taste very mild and not overpowering at all, and there was a terrific hint of orange from the marmalade. I left the onions out (DS hates them). What was lacking was salt; I added some to the sauce at the end and also sprinkled a little over the chops, but I believe the sauce should have salt as an ingredient. My pork chops were quite thick, about an inch, and 30 minutes of simmering was perfect. I increased the sauce ingredients by 50% because DH and I like lots of sauce — and I had 5 pieces of pork, not 4 — but that wasn't necessary as there would have been more than enough (I served the sauce on the side, in the photo I only drizzled a small amount over the meat). This was easy to prepare and I look forward to making it again!
